Ingredients You’ll Need

What’s fantastic about this Fudgy Mint Chocolate No-Bake Cookies Recipe is the simplicity and accessibility of the ingredients. Each element plays an essential role in creating the cookie’s signature texture, flavor, and irresistible fudginess.

  • Unsalted butter (1/2 cup): Provides richness and helps bind the ingredients together while giving a smooth mouthfeel.
  • Granulated sugar (2 cups): Sweetens the cookies and helps them set properly once cooled.
  • Whole milk (1/2 cup): Adds moisture and creaminess to the chocolate mixture.
  • Unsweetened cocoa powder (1/4 cup): Brings deep chocolate flavor and beautiful dark color.
  • Salt (1/4 teaspoon): Enhances the flavors and balances the sweetness perfectly.
  • Peppermint extract (1/2 teaspoon): Infuses the refreshing minty aroma and taste that makes this recipe stand out.
  • Quick-cooking oats (3 cups): Adds hearty texture and helps absorb the fudgy chocolate mixture.
  • Semisweet chocolate chips (1/2 cup): Melts into the cookies for luscious chocolate bursts.
  • Optional crushed peppermint candies or mini chocolate chips: For an extra festive and crunchy topping.

How to Make Fudgy Mint Chocolate No-Bake Cookies Recipe

Step 1: Prepare Your Workspace

Start by lining a baking sheet with parchment paper to ensure your cookies won’t stick once spooned out. Having everything ready to go here makes the next steps smoother and faster because you want to work quickly while the chocolate mixture is warm.

Step 2: Create the Chocolate Mixture

In a medium saucepan, combine the unsalted butter, granulated sugar, whole milk, unsweetened cocoa powder, and salt over medium heat. Stir frequently as the ingredients come together, watching closely until the mixture reaches a rolling boil. This stage is crucial—let it boil for exactly one minute to achieve the perfect consistency for your cookies to set later.

Step 3: Add the Peppermint and Mix-Ins

Once you remove your saucepan from heat, immediately stir in that delightful peppermint extract, followed by the quick-cooking oats and semisweet chocolate chips. Stir energetically until the chocolate chips melt into the fudgy base, enveloping every oat for a luscious texture.

Step 4: Form the Cookies

Working quickly, drop spoonfuls of the mixture onto your parchment-lined baking sheet. Shape each dollop gently into a cookie form. This part is fun and a bit hands-on, so embrace the rustic charm of these no-bake treats. If you want to add a little something extra, sprinkle crushed peppermint candies or mini chocolate chips on top while the cookies are still warm and inviting.

Step 5: Let Them Set

Allow your cookies to cool at room temperature for about 30 to 45 minutes. This resting time lets them set into those perfectly fudgy and chewy bites you’re aiming for, without needing any baking at all.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Once fully set, store your leftover no-bake c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to one week. Keeping them sealed maintains their fudgy texture and minty freshness. For a slightly firmer texture, you can refrigerate them after they are set, especially during warmer months.

Freezing

These cookies also freeze beautifully. Place them in a single layer on a baking sheet to freeze initially, then transfer to a freezer-safe container or bag. They’ll keep well for up to three months. When you’re ready to enjoy them again, simply thaw at room temperature for about 30 minutes.

Reheating

Since these cookies are no-bake and fudgy, reheating isn’t necessary. However, if you prefer them slightly warm, pop a cookie in the microwave for 8 to 10 seconds to soften the chocolate slightly without losing their structure.

FAQs

Can I use quick oats instead of quick-cooking oats?

Quick oats and quick-cooking oats are quite similar, so substituting one for the other works just fine here. The important thing is to use oats that cook quickly to achieve the right fudgy texture without being too chewy or dry.

Is there a way to make these cookies dairy-free?

Absolutely! You can swap the unsalted butter for a dairy-free margarine or coconut oil and use a plant-based milk like almond, oat, or soy milk. Just keep in mind that flavors may vary slightly but they’ll still be delicious.

How can I adjust the mint flavor if I want it stronger or milder?

The recipe calls for 1/2 teaspoon of peppermint extract, but feel free to adjust to your personal taste. Start with less if unsure; you can always add a bit more after tasting the mixture before spooning onto the tray.

Can I skip the chocolate chips?

While the semisweet chocolate chips add delightful pockets of melty chocolate, you can omit them for a simpler version. However, keep in mind that they contribute to the fudgy texture and richness, so you might find your cookies slightly less decadent without them.

What makes this a no-bake recipe?

Unlike traditional cookies, this recipe doesn’t require an oven. The mixture thickens and sets simply by boiling briefly and then cooling, which is perfect for those hot days when you want a sweet treat without heating up your kitchen.

Ingredients

Scale

Cookie Base

  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ter
  • 2 cups granulated sugar
  • 1/2 cup whole milk
  • 1/4 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t

Flavoring & Mix-ins

  • 1/2 teaspoon peppermint extract
  • 3 cups quick-cooking oats
  • 1/2 cup semisweet chocolate chips

Toppings (Optional)

  • Crushed peppermint candies or mini chocolate chips for topping


Instructions

  1. Prepare baking sheet: Line a baking sheet with parchment paper and set aside to prevent sticking and allow cookies to cool evenly.
  2. Combine ingredients: In a medium saucepan over medium heat, combine the unsalted butter, granulated sugar, whole milk, unsweetened cocoa powder, and salt. Stir frequently to blend thoroughly and prevent scorching.
  3. Boil mixture: Bring the mixture to a rolling boil and allow it to boil for exactly 1 minute. This step ensures the sugar dissolves fully and the cookie mixture thickens properly.
  4. Remove from heat and add flavor: Remove the saucepan from heat immediately after boiling. Stir in the peppermint extract, quick-cooking oats, and semisweet chocolate chips until the mixture is fully combined and the chocolate chips have melted, creating a fudgy texture.
  5. Form cookies: Working quickly, drop spoonfuls of the mixture onto the prepared baking sheet, shaping them into cookies. Optionally sprinkle the tops with crushed peppermint candies or mini chocolate chips while cookies are still warm to add extra festive flavor and texture.
  6. Cool and set: Allow the cookies to cool at room temperature for 30 to 45 minutes, or until fully set and firm enough to handle.

Notes

  • Store c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 1 week.
  • For a firmer texture, refrigerate the cookies after they have set.
  • Adjust the amount of peppermint extract to your liking for a milder or stronger mint flavor.
